Key Distinctions In Between Treatments
When it involves acne treatments, comprehending the vital distinctions can make a significant impact on your skin's wellness.
You'll find 2 primary groups: over the counter (OTC) and prescription therapies. On the other hand, prescription treatments typically consist of more powerful energetic ingredients, like retinoids or prescription antibiotics, and are customized for more severe cases. These treatments frequently call for a dermatologist's guidance, enabling them to target details skin issues successfully.
The toughness and solution of prescription alternatives can lead to quicker results yet may also come with a greater risk of adverse effects.
You must also consider your skin kind and any kind of level of sensitivities when picking a therapy. For instance, if you have sensitive skin, OTC treatments may be a gentler beginning point.
Inevitably, understanding these distinctions assists you make educated options regarding your acne therapy journey and leads you toward more clear skin.
Advantages and disadvantages of Prescription Choices
Prescription options for acne therapy come with both advantages and downsides that you need to evaluate meticulously.
One major pro is their effectiveness. Prescription medications often have higher concentrations of active components, which can cause faster and more effective outcomes compared to non-prescription (OTC) products. You might likewise discover that prescriptions are customized to your particular skin type and acne seriousness, offering a more individualized strategy.
On the flip side, these treatments can come with considerable drawbacks. For one, they may have negative effects ranging from light inflammation to a lot more severe complications, which you require to keep an eye on carefully.
Additionally, prescription therapies can be extra pricey, especially if your insurance policy doesn't cover them. You could additionally face obstacles in getting a prescription, as it calls for a visit to a healthcare provider, which can be lengthy and bothersome.
Advantages of OTC Treatments
OTC treatments frequently offer a convenient and accessible solution for handling acne. You can quickly find these items in drug stores, supermarket, or online, making them conveniently offered over the counter. This accessibility suggests you can begin your acne treatment whenever you need to, without waiting on a medical professional's visit.
One more significant advantage of OTC treatments is their affordability. Many over the counter options are budget-friendly, enabling you to check out numerous formulas without breaking the bank. You can attempt various items to see what jobs best for your skin kind.
OTC therapies likewise can be found in a variety of formulas, including gels, creams, and washes. This variety enables you to pick a product that fits your lifestyle and preferences. Numerous include active ingredients like benzoyl peroxide or salicylic acid, which are effective in treating acne.
Finally, you have the liberty to adjust your regimen based on your skin's action. If one product isn't working, you can quickly switch over to another without an extensive assessment process. This flexibility encourages you to take control of your acne management journey.
